The Director of Scream 7 Was Forced to Leave the Film After Receiving ‘Very Frightening’ Death Threats
Image: Getty Images
Christopher Landon, the recently appointed director of *Scream 7*, has made the heartbreaking decision to step away from the film. This decision comes in light of alarming death threats directed at him and his family following the controversial dismissal of actress Melissa Barrera from the franchise. Barrera’s exit stemmed from remarks she made on social media regarding the Israel-Palestine conflict, which many interpreted as antisemitic.

New Leadership for Scream 7
In the aftermath of Landon’s resignation, the franchise sought a replacement director who could navigate the challenges ahead. Kevin Williamson, a veteran of the *Scream* series, has stepped in to take the helm of the project. Williamson returns to the franchise with experience and a better understanding of the delicate balance between artistic expression and public sentiment.
The existing cast has signaled their continuity with the series, as both Neve Campbell and Courteney Cox are slated to reprise their iconic roles. Additionally, beloved actors Matthew Lillard, Scott Foley, and David Arquette are set to return, which keeps the fan-favorite elements intact despite the ongoing controversies.
